Commercial Fence Painting in Pinellas County, FL
Commercial fence painting services involve applying fresh coats of paint or stain to existing fences on commercial properties, including retail centers, industrial sites, and office complexes. This service is designed to enhance the appearance of fences made from various materials such as wood, metal, vinyl, or composite, helping property owners maintain a professional and inviting exterior. Projects can range from touch-up work on existing fences to complete repainting of large perimeter boundaries, security enclosures, or decorative fencing, ensuring the property looks well-maintained and visually appealing.
Property owners considering fence painting typically want to understand the condition of the current fence, the types of paint or stain suitable for their specific material, and the overall scope of the project. It’s important to evaluate whether the existing surface needs repairs or prep work prior to painting, as well as selecting colors or finishes that complement the property’s overall aesthetic. Proper preparation and quality application can extend the lifespan of the fence and improve curb appeal, making it a worthwhile investment for maintaining a professional property exterior.
